31A-19a-405. Filing of rates and other rating information.
(a)All workers' compensation rates, supplementary rate information, and supporting information shall be filed at least 30 days before the effective date of the rate or information.
(b)Notwithstanding Subsection (1)(a) , on application by the filer, the commissioner may authorize an earlier effective date.
(2)The loss and loss adjustment expense factors included in the rates filed under Subsection
(1)shall be:
(a)the advisory loss costs filed by the designated rate service organization under Section 31A-19a-406 ; or
(b)a percent modification of the advisory loss costs filed by the designated rate service organization under Section 31A-19a-406 .
(3)A modification filed under Subsection (2)(b) shall be accompanied by adequate support as required by Part 2, General Rate Regulation .
Amended by Chapter 32 , 2020 General Session
